+ case Intrinsic::amdgcn_s_buffer_load: {
+ static const OpRegBankEntry<2> Table[4] = {
+ // Perfectly legal.
+ { { AMDGPU::SGPRRegBankID, AMDGPU::SGPRRegBankID }, 1 },
+
+ // Only need 1 register in loop
+ { { AMDGPU::SGPRRegBankID, AMDGPU::VGPRRegBankID }, 300 },
+
+ // Have to waterfall the resource.
+ { { AMDGPU::VGPRRegBankID, AMDGPU::SGPRRegBankID }, 1000 },
+
+ // Have to waterfall the resource, and the offset.
+ { { AMDGPU::VGPRRegBankID, AMDGPU::VGPRRegBankID }, 1500 }
+ };
+
+ // rsrc, offset
+ const std::array<unsigned, 2> RegSrcOpIdx = { 2, 3 };
+ return addMappingFromTable<2>(MI, MRI, RegSrcOpIdx, makeArrayRef(Table));
+ }
